Thermostat explodes causing smoke in Pine Ridge residence, Bushkill PA
A thermostat exploded in a residence near Cramer Road in Pine Ridge, causing a brief flame and smoke. Smoke detectors were sounding inside the house. Fire units responded to the possible structure fire.
